Each of the recipes includes an introductory description, ingredients listed in a bullet point sidebar (US measurements only), and step by step instructions. Nutritional info is not included. I believe all of the recipes are accompanied by photographs. The photos provided are high quality and clear and serving suggestions are attractive and appropriate.
